Guide for Inmate Family Members: Sealy Police Jail, Texas
Overview of the Facility
The Sealy Police Jail is a short-term facility where inmates are held until they are either transferred to a state or county prison or released after agreeing to appear in court. It is primarily used for holding individuals convicted of misdemeanors and those awaiting trial for minor offenses.

How to Locate an Inmate
To locate an inmate, you may call the Sealy Police Jail at the phone number provided. They can offer guidance on the inmate's status and location.
Visitation Information and Hours
Visitors are required to contact the Sealy Police Jail directly at (979) 885-2913 to inquire about visitation schedules and regulations. Normally, visitors should be on the inmate's visitation list and must present valid identification.

Phone Calls and Video Options
Inmates at Sealy Police Jail are typically allowed to make outgoing phone calls, but the calls must be collect or paid through a phone account established with the facility. Video visitation options are not mentioned; please verify directly with the facility.
Inmate Services and Programs
The services and programs available at Sealy Police Jail are limited due to its nature as a short-term holding facility. Basic services like food, healthcare, and access to a phone are provided.

Booking and Release Process
Individuals are typically booked following arrest and held pending a court appearance. Release processes are determined by court orders or after completion of the sentence for misdemeanor charges.
